One of the first things I noticed was the ease of installation. Govee’s app is user-friendly, and setting up my RGBW bulbs was a breeze. I was particularly impressed with how smoothly they integrated with my existing smart home ecosystem. However, I did run into an issue where my bulbs wouldn’t turn off completely through my home automation system. After some research, I discovered that adjusting the brightness to 0 wasn’t always reliable, so I ended up creating a custom automation to ensure a clean off state.
